In The Spirit of Gallipoli, Patrick Lindsay explores the source of the Anzac legend as he continues his quest to understand what it means to be Australian.

Patrick writes for those who would never wade through a fully-fledged history book but want to understand the remarkable spirit that emerged from a doomed campaign. He digs deep into the bedrock of the Australian character. He examines the spirit that sets Australians apart and enables them to often fight above their weight on the international stage.

He places the Gallipoli campaign in context, telling the story through the eyes of those who were there, and he delves into the remarkable spirit which sustained the Anzacs as they clung to the ridges in their baptism of fire, half a world from their homelands.

The Spirit of Gallipoli is a must-read for those who want to understand the Anzac spirit and where it was forged. (publisher blurb)
